Doodles is a next-generation storytelling brand that combines digital media, on-chain technology, and community creativity. Initially launched in 2021 as a leading NFT collection, Doodles has since evolved into a transmedia universe fueled by art, animation, music, and gamified digital experiences. The mission is to build the world's most engaging on-chain media franchise. The DOOD token powers their ecosystem, integrates with DreamNet, and incentivizes community participation.
